Sophie Howard

Sophie Howard is a central defender with extensive international experience. Born in 1993, she holds dual German and British nationality. Her career includes notable stints in several top international leagues.

In Germany, she played for Hoffenheim, while in the United States she represented the Colorado Rapids Women. She later moved to England, where she spent six seasons in the top division—first with Reading, and then, starting in 2020, with Leicester City. With the Foxes, she established herself as a key figure in defense, becoming a leader and reliable presence on the pitch, even wearing the captain’s armband.

Howard also boasts several appearances for Germany’s U20 national team, with whom she won a silver medal at the 2012 U20 World Cup, as well as over 60 caps for the Scottish senior national team, which she has represented since 2017.
